Sadly, thoug...If your score for magic evasion is 8-40%, that means you get 8 attempts to avoid that spell, with each attempt having a 40% chance. (Damage spells won't miss you, but as I recall you can avoid bonus damage from each hit). Note that the spell Shell works by increasing your magic evasion number. Like, if your magic evasion is 4-50% and you cast ...IIRC, the magic EXP formula is: (Casts * 2) + average enemy rank + 2 - spell level. Meaning you actually start with negative EXP at high levels and need to spend at least a few turns casting in battle before you actually gain any EXP at all. Pixel Remaster has a new stat displayed that was previously hidden stat that was informally called a Magic Penalty, now called Magic Interference. The less penalty you give this stat, the more potent your Magic will be.You can choose to dual-wield if 10% magic accuracy penalty is tolerable, since you can't use a Shield without a massive penalty. For Final Fantasy II Pixel Remaster on the PC, a GameFAQs message board topic titled "Magic Penalty from Gear" - Page 3.One thing you may want to account for is the magic penalty for wearing certain equipment (usually the heavier stuff). Namely, swords, spears and shields all have pretty big penalties to your magic power, limiting your white/black magic potency.
